Job Description

Job Summary:

We are seeking a reliable and safety-conscious CDL Driver / Sign Installer to join our team. This dual-role position involves operating commercial vehicles to transport materials and equipment to job sites, as well as performing hands-on installation of a variety of signage, including pole signs, monument signs, wall signs, and digital displays.

Shift - Mon-Thurs 5:30 am - 4 pm; overtime is Friday

Key Responsibilities:

  • Operate company vehicles (typically bucket trucks, cranes, or flatbeds) to transport and install signage.
  • Assist with the loading and unloading of sign materials and equipment.
  • Install signs at client locations according to design specifications and safety standards.
  • Perform layout and positioning of signs based on drawings, blueprints, and site surveys.
  • Safely operate lifts, cranes, hand tools, power tools, and other equipment.
  • Ensure all installations meet company quality standards and comply with local codes.
  • Perform daily vehicle inspections and ensure compliance with DOT regulations.
  • Maintain clean and organized vehicles, tools, and workspaces.
  • Follow all safety procedures and use proper personal protective equipment (PPE).
  • Communicate professionally with customers, contractors, and team members on-site.

Qualifications:

  • Valid CDL (Class A or B) required, with a clean driving record.
  • 1+ years of experience in sign installation or related construction/electrical field preferred.
  • Comfortable working at heights using ladders, scaffolding, and aerial lifts.
  • Ability to read and interpret blueprints, site plans, and technical drawings.
  • Familiarity with OSHA safety standards and DOT regulations.
  • Strong mechanical aptitude and problem-solving skills.
